On Monday NCP chief said that we need to be prepared for the impact of coronavirus on the country's economy as business activities are suspended.

The former Union minister also requested people to stop unnecessary expenditures and stay home to avoid the spread of the deathly viral infection.

"We should be ready to brace the impact of looming economic crisis over the country as all types of business activities are suspended. People need to do away with their unnecessary spending habit for the next coming weeks as the country's economic situation looks grim, he said.

"I also appeal to people to stay at home and prevent the spread of coronavirus infection. Otherwise, police will have to use force to keep them indoors," he said.
